"...The source area of the Stübenbach is on the 1,386 meter high Stübenwasen. From there it meanders through the high valley of Todtnauberg, where other clear mountain streams join it. These then plunge together with a loud roar in two stages over a huge granite massif into the valley. The completely natural waterfall has been a listed monument since June 1987 and is one of the ten most beautiful natural monuments in Germany. ..." https://www.feldbergbahn.de/Attraktionen/Todtnauer-Wasserfall

Frequently Asked Questions

What makes the Todtnau Waterfall a must-visit natural monument near Aitern?

The Todtnau Waterfall is one of Germany's highest natural waterfalls, cascading an impressive 97 meters over five steps. Its geological formation, carved through granite and gneiss, creates a spectacular sight. Visitors can enjoy various hiking trails, including the 'Wasserfallsteig' gourmet trail, and even find wooden relaxation loungers along the path. In winter, it can freeze into extraordinary icicle formations.

Can I spot any unique wildlife or plants at the Belchen Summit?

The Belchen Summit is part of a nature reserve and is known for its rare flora and fauna. It is home to unique species of butterflies, beetles, birds, and ice-age relict plants that are otherwise found only in the Alps. The mountain's status as a nature reserve since 1949 protects this biodiversity.

What geological points of interest are there besides the main natural monuments?

While not a traditional natural monument, the **Aitern Süd Mine** is a geological point of interest near the village. Its lower gallery, visible near a small river in Aitern, showcases fluorite, baryte, lead ore, and chalcopyrite veins, with mining activities dating back to the Middle Ages.

What makes the Belchen Summit unique in terms of its shape and geology?

The Belchen Summit has a distinctive, almost symmetrical, domed and treeless profile when viewed from the Upper Rhine Plain. Geologically, the mountain consists of granite, which contrasts with the mostly gneiss formations found in the surrounding areas.
